Mining and Water Quality. Mine drainage is metal-rich water formed from a chemical reaction between water and rocks containing sulfur-bearing minerals. Long-time and intensive mining has caused spatiotemporal cumulative effects on soil, water, air environment, and ecosystem, which include ground subsidence, hydrodynamics change, land use change, soil pollution, air pollution, and ecosystem evolution etc.
Miners and farmers were often at loggerheads over the effects of one enterprise on the other. Poisonous underground gases, mostly containing sulfur, were released into the atmosphere. Removing gold from quartz required mercury, the excess of which polluted local streams and rivers. Strip mining caused erosion and further desertification.

Mineral exploration activities fall into 4 classes under the Quartz Mining Land Use Regulations. As the class increases so does the potential to cause negative impacts to the environment. Knowing your mining class is essential to knowing the limits of land and water disturbances for your program.

Apr 26, 2021 The pit filled back up with 40 billion gallons of acidic water. Today the pit, its tailings ponds and groundwater have high concentrations of heavy metals. The Berkeley Pit is a terminal sink so all the contaminated surface and ground water flows into it. Now Butte is the largest U.S. Environmental Protection Agency (EPA) Superfund site in America.
Mining is an inherently invasive process that can cause damage to a landscape in an area much larger than the mining site itself. The effects of this damage can continue years after a mine has shut down, including the addition to greenhouse gasses, death of flora and fauna, and erosion of land and habitat.
One of the major effects of mining is its impact on ground and surface waters. This, along with other disturbances, make the ecosystem to meet with grevious consequences. Generally speaking, the small-scale mining described above has minimal environmental impact. However, there are issues in most types of mining that include destruction of landscapes and agricultural and forest lands, sedimentation and erosion, soil contamination and surface and groundwater pollution, air pollution, and waste management.
